Chickpea

Chickpeas, also known as garbanzo beans, are a nutrient-dense legume rich in protein, fiber, and essential vitamins and minerals. They are widely used in various cuisines and are known for their health benefits.

Chickpeas are an excellent source of plant-based protein, making them a great option for vegetarians and vegans.
High in dietary fiber, chickpeas can aid in digestion and help maintain a healthy gut.

Adzuki Bean

Adzuki beans are small, red legumes known for their sweet flavor and high nutritional value. They are rich in protein, fiber, and essential nutrients, making them a popular choice in various cuisines.

Adzuki beans are an excellent source of plant-based protein, which supports muscle growth and repair.
They are high in dietary fiber, promoting digestive health and aiding in weight management.
